In the first quarter of 2025, the top music games on the Android platform in Slovenia displayed varied performance trends, as reported by Sensor Tower. Here's a closer look at the key metrics for these applications.
My Singing Monsters from Big Blue Bubble Inc saw a notable increase in weekly revenue, reaching approximately $46 in early March. The app's downloads remained relatively stable, peaking at 11K in mid-February, while weekly active users experienced a gradual decline from 115K to 79K by the end of the quarter.
Geometry Dash by RobTop Games had fluctuating revenue, with a peak of $36 in late January. However, no download data was recorded during the quarter, and active user numbers were not available.
Beatstar - Touch Your Music from Space Ape demonstrated a varied revenue trend, peaking at $24 in late February. Downloads were minimal, with a high of 7K at the start of the quarter. Active users decreased from 244K to 134K over the three months.
Groove Masters - DJ Drum Pad by Playcus Limited showed a significant increase in weekly downloads, reaching 51K in early February. Revenue peaked at $31 in early March, while active users remained consistently around 280K to 296K throughout the quarter.
Cytus II from Rayark International Limited had minimal revenue, peaking at $31 in early February. The app's downloads were sporadic, with a maximum of 4K during the same period, and no active user data was available.
